@aplus-frontend/ui
Version:
28 lines (27 loc) • 886 B
JavaScript
import { defineComponent as s, createBlock as a, openBlock as c, unref as o, mergeProps as n, withCtx as u, renderSlot as l } from "vue";
import { Input as f } from "@aplus-frontend/antdv";
import "../../../config-provider/index.mjs";
import i from "../../style/item-text-group.mjs";
import { useNamespace as d } from "../../../config-provider/hooks/use-namespace.mjs";
const k = /* @__PURE__ */ s({
name: "ApFormItemTextGroup",
__name: "group",
props: {
size: {},
compact: { type: Boolean, default: !1 }
},
setup(t) {
const { b: r } = d("ap-form-item-text-group"), p = i("ap-form-item-text-group"), m = t;
return (e, _) => (c(), a(o(f).Group, n({
class: [e.$props.compact ? o(r)("compact") : null, o(p)]
}, m), {
default: u(() => [
l(e.$slots, "default")
]),
_: 3
}, 16, ["class"]));
}
});
export {
k as default
};